well, the better answer is that supercharging doesn't work with 2 strokes, both the intake and exhaust ports are open at the same time, supercharging, or forced air induction wouldn't work, it'd just blow all the air in and out, no power gains, if only i had a quarter for everytime someone asked this...

Just to add something, supercharging (or turbocharging for that matter) is possible on 2-stroke engine in general, but it depends on the design. See here:
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Two-str...e_design_types
The piston controlled inlet port design looks like what the typical nitro engine uses. Not very efficient, but cheap and easy to make.
